2010-11-18 99 views
17
访问

我已经创建了一个新的类在App_Code文件类在App_Code文件没有的Global.asax.cs

namespace Site { 
    public class MyClass { 
     public MyClass() { 
     } 
    } 
} 

这是我的Global.asax.cs

namespace Site { 
    public class Global : System.Web.HttpApplication { 
     protected void Application_Start(object sender, EventArgs e) { 
      *MyClass myClass = new MyClass();* 
     } 
    } 
} 

的错误是: MyClass myClass = new MyClass();

类型或命名空间名称“MyClass的”找不到(是否缺少using指令或程序集引用?)

缺少什么我在这里?

+0

我在App_Code中有其他类。我试过将MyClass粘贴到其中一个类中,Global.asax.cs可以找到MyClass。奇怪的。 – acermate433s 2010-11-18 23:00:04

回答

25

终于发现出了什么问题。我已经将cs文件的Build Action设置为内容而不是编译

+0

谢谢,你救了我的夜晚! – 2013-12-11 18:57:19